Eigenviews for Object Recognition in Multispectral Imaging Systems

We address the problem of representing multispectral images
of objects using eigenviews for recognition purposes.
Eigenviews have long been used for object recognition and
pose estimation purposes in the grayscale and color image
settings. The purpose of this paper is two-fold: firstly to extend
the idealogies of eigenviews to multispectral images
and secondly to propose the use of dimensionality reduction
techniques other than those popularly used. Principal
Component Analysis (PCA) and its various kernel-based
flavors are popularly used to extract eigenviews. We propose
the use of Independent Component Analysis (ICA) and
Non-negative Matrix Factorization (NMF) as possible candidates
for eigenview extraction. Multispectral images of a
collection of 3D objects captured under different viewpoint
locations are used to obtain representative views (eigen-views)
that encode the information in these images. The
idea is illustrated with a collection of eight synthetic objects
imaged in both reflection and emission bands. A Nearest
Neighbor classifier is used to perform the classification
of an arbitrary view of an object. Classifier performance
under additive white Gaussian noise is also tested. The results
demonstrate that this system holds promise for use
in object recognition under the multispectral imaging setting
and also for novel dimensionality reduction techniques.
The number of eigenviews needed by various techniques to
obtain a given classifier accuracy is also calculated as a
measure of the performance of the dimensionality reduction
technique.
